Rodolfo Ungerfeld is a scholar working on Agronomy and Crop Science, Small Animals and Genetics. According to data from OpenAlex, Rodolfo Ungerfeld has authored 291 papers receiving a total of 3.4k indexed citations (citations by other indexed papers that have themselves been cited), including 184 papers in Agronomy and Crop Science, 121 papers in Small Animals and 115 papers in Genetics. Recurrent topics in Rodolfo Ungerfeld's work include Reproductive Physiology in Livestock (180 papers), Animal Behavior and Welfare Studies (119 papers) and Genetic and phenotypic traits in livestock (103 papers). Rodolfo Ungerfeld is often cited by papers focused on Reproductive Physiology in Livestock (180 papers), Animal Behavior and Welfare Studies (119 papers) and Genetic and phenotypic traits in livestock (103 papers). Rodolfo Ungerfeld collaborates with scholars based in Uruguay, Brazil and Mexico. Rodolfo Ungerfeld's co-authors include E. Rubianes, María José Hötzel, Aline Freitas‐de‐Melo, Juan Pablo Damián, M. Forsberg, Agustı́n Orihuela, Daniel Enríquez-Hidalgo, G. Quintans, Raquel Pérez-Clariget and William Pérez and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Scientific Reports.
